Transaction 31ed29bfd66757e01aeeb4c35219229acf55b24b2032dd65e4af1a7856ebc55c

2 Input
2 Outputs
  • 31ed29bfd66757e01aeeb4c35219229acf55b24b2032dd65e4af1a7856ebc55c:0
  • value  254205
    address  1LPPVx2PqsXeeAteUM8gTZtXjmPpbiL2bA
  • 31ed29bfd66757e01aeeb4c35219229acf55b24b2032dd65e4af1a7856ebc55c:1
  • value  50104704
    address  181xubERnJWMXGHcbszrE3mMiWwDWfsiQ4